11. s possible 4 Separate AC line and external I O signal of positioning module so that I O signal is not affected by surge or induction noise generated at AC line 5 Use stable power as external power DC5V DC24V 6 When wiring if wire is close to high temperature device or contacts with oil it may be the reason of short ESS This section explains the initial installation and parameter setting method of APM Advance Positioning Module The following procedures should be followed in order Y ESSN 1 Wire the pulse output terminal of positioning module and the pulse input terminal of motor drive Refer to the motor drive user s manual for the accurate wiring 2 Connecting input signal terminal is not necessary for the initial setting and test 3 Connect to positioning module through XG5000 Refer to the user s manual for the usage of XG5000 4 Open a new file after connection 5 Use the monitoring function of the XG5000 to check the input signals on the external Operation signal window All input signals are displayed as Off condition 6 The settings of the pulse output mode of basic parameter in XG5000 and pulse input mode of motor drive are identical Refer to driver s user manual and confirm the current pulse input mode of motor drive Thereafter set all input signal parameters as A contact point 7 Download the parameters and operating data using Data Read Write of XG5000 monitoring window If downlo
